Why can't you simply slap in a new air conditioning and call it a day? Well, think of everyone doing that. Mayhem? Allows exist to ensure your installation fulfills safety requirements and adhere to local building regulations. They help prevent shoddy craftsmanship, secure your residential or commercial property value, and, most importantly, keep you and your neighbors safe. Believe of it like this: it's a little extra documents now for a great deal of assurance later.
Okay, so how do you in fact get a license? The process can differ a bit depending upon your area in Phoenix Park Jacksonville FL. Usually, you'll need to apply through your regional city or county building department. This generally includes submitting detailed strategies of the AC system, its location, and how it will be installed. Typically, your a/c specialist will handle this entire procedure for you, which is a substantial relief. They're familiar with the local requirements and can browse the bureaucracy much more efficiently than you probably could. It resembles having a translator for government-speak.
While particular regulations can get quite technical, here are a few basic areas they often cover:
A reliable and certified heating and cooling contractor will be skilled in all the necessary permits and policies. They should be able to explain the procedure clearly, get the necessary licenses on your behalf, and ensure that the a/c setup satisfies all suitable codes. In fact, if a specialist attempts to talk you out of getting a license, that's a major red flag. It's like a physician telling you to skip that check-up-- not a great idea!
Believing of cutting corners and avoiding the authorization procedure? Reconsider. The repercussions can be quite undesirable. You could deal with fines, be forced to remove the unpermitted work, or even have trouble offering your home down the road. Plus, if something fails with the installation, your insurer may not cover the damages. In the long run, it's generally cheaper and easier to do things the proper way from the start. This is your traditional, whole-house solution. However here's something they don't always inform you: ductwork is crucial. If your existing ductwork is leaky, cracked, or just plain ancient, you're essentially throwing money out the window. Think of trying to fill a pail with holes-- discouraging, best? Consider having your ductwork inspected and sealed before installation. This can significantly enhance efficiency and save you a package in the long run. Something that can be a problem is the disruption to your home during the installation process. It's not just the sound; it's the dust, the installers traipsing through, and the short-term loss of environment control. Plan appropriately, perhaps schedule it throughout a cooler week, and absolutely purchase some good air filters for after the install.
No ducts? No problem! Ductless mini-splits are acquiring appeal for a reason. Ever want you could cool just particular rooms? This is your answer. Perfect for additions, transformed garages, or homes without existing ductwork. A lesser recognized concern is positioning of the indoor systems. No one desires an eyesore on their wall. Believe tactically about where they will go. Think about factors like sunlight exposure, furniture placement, and airflow. A somewhat less obvious inconvenience is the outdoor unit. It needs to be available for maintenance, however you do not want it destroying your curb appeal. Speak to your installer about hiding it with landscaping or an ornamental screen. Also, ensure it's not put where it will annoy your neighbors with sound.
Economical and simple to set up, window systems provide a momentary option for single rooms. They are the easiest to install, however are the least effective. The biggest thing to consider is that you're literally obstructing a window. That suggests less natural light and a potential security vulnerability. Reinforce the unit with brackets and think about a window lock for included protection. An obscure trick? Clean the filter frequently. A dirty filter chokes the system and makes it work harder, squandering energy. Set a tip on your phone-- you'll thank yourself later.
Don't let the name fool you; heatpump both heat and cool. In Phoenix Park Jacksonville FL's moderate winter seasons, they can be extremely efficient. An obstacle lots of people face is understanding the limitations in extreme temperatures. While they excel in moderate environments, their performance drops when temperatures plunge. Consider a hybrid system that integrates a heatpump with a backup furnace for optimal efficiency. Routine upkeep is important. Set up annual checkups to guarantee peak performance and prevent costly repairs. A properly maintained heatpump can last for many years and conserve you a considerable amount on energy expenses.

Ever question why your neighbor paid seemingly less than you did for their new AC system? Numerous aspects influence the last price tag of a/c setup in Phoenix Park Jacksonville FL. The size of your home is a major determinant; a sprawling estate naturally requires a more effective (and pricier) system than a cozy bungalow. However it's more nuanced than simply square footage.
The type of system you choose also plays a significant function. Are you leaning towards a traditional split system, a ductless mini-split, or possibly a packaged system? Each has its own cost range, and the very best option depends upon your specific requirements and existing facilities. Consider it like picking a cars and truck-- a basic sedan will cost less than a completely filled SUV.
One often-overlooked aspect is the condition of your existing ductwork. If it's old, dripping, or incorrectly sized, you might be tossing money away on energy expenses (Air Conditioning Tune Up Service Phoenix Park Jacksonville FL). Envision attempting to fill a bucket with holes-- no matter how much water you put in, you'll still lose some. Ductwork repair or replacement can contribute to the preliminary cost, however it's a worthwhile investment in the long run
Another potential difficulty: electrical upgrades. Older homes may not have the electrical capability to deal with a modern-day, high-efficiency air conditioner system. This in some cases requires upgrading your electrical panel, which can be an unanticipated expenditure. A licensed electrical expert can examine your home's electrical system and encourage on any needed upgrades.
SEER (Seasonal Energy Effectiveness Ratio) is a vital aspect. While a greater SEER score translates to greater energy savings with time, it also usually features a greater in advance expense. It's a balancing act: just how much are you ready to invest at first to minimize your regular monthly energy costs? Consider your long-term strategies for your home. If you plan to stay for lots of years, a higher SEER score might be the better choice.
Have you considered the placement of the outdoor unit? Ensuring it's on level ground and has proper clearance for airflow is necessary for optimum performance and durability. Often, this requires additional site preparation, which can affect the total expense.

Often, the early indication of decreasing efficiency are subtle. Are specific rooms not cooling as well as others? Is your system biking on and off more often than usual? Are you hearing unusual noises coming from your system? These might be indicators that something is wrong. Addressing these problems quickly can prevent them from escalating into more expensive repair work or replacements.
